No experience required.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ience working in a rehabilitation environment or education related to a rehabilitation career path preferred.
Current CPR certification from an AHA-approved course provider
Job Description:
Assists licensed physical and occupational therapist, physical, occupational therapy assistants, and students in all aspects of treatment in order to maximize each patient's functional ability.
JOB DUTIES
- Transfers and transports patients in a safe and timely manner
- While under direct supervision of the treating therapist, the rehabilitation aide will assist with direct patient care relative to patient's age, culture, and condition
- Communicates verbally and in written form with therapists, assistants, students, customers, volunteers and other aides to maintain efficient workflow.
- Maintains linen, disinfects equipment, sterilizes equipment, and tracks reusable supplies.
- Maintains clean working environment.
- Receives, distributes, and restocks supplies.
- Performs related duties as required.
- Files, answers and makes telephone calls, performs departmental copying.
